코딩
[Programming] 쉽게 풀어쓴 C언어 Express 8장 풀이
01. 주어진 실수를 제곱하여 반환하는 함수 double square(double)을 작성한다. square() 함수를 테스트하는 프로그램을 작성하라. Hint : double형을 입력받을 때는 scanf("%lf", &x)를 사용한다 #include #pragma warning (disable:4996) double square(double x) { return x * x; } int main() { double x; printf("정수를 입력하시오: "); scanf("%lf", &x); printf("주어진 정수 %lf의 제곱은 %lf입니다.\n", x, square(x)); } 02. 전달된 문자가 알파벳 문자인지 아닌지를 검사하는 함수 check_alpha()를 작성하고 이것을 호출하여서 사용자..
[JS 클론코딩] 노마드코더 JS크롬앱만들기
console.log("str"); console에 괄호 안의 내용 출력 MDN Mozilla Developer Network VS Code 단축키 다중선택 Alt + Click Shift + Alt + 드래그 Alt + Click -> Shift + 방향키 변수 const a : 상수, 변경 불가 //default let a : 변경 가능 //업데이트가 필요한 경우 var : 구버전, 변경에 대한 규칙X, 비추천 데이터 타입 boolean : true, false null :없다, 비어있음을 명시 undefined : 정의되지 않음 배열 const name = [1 ,null ,true ,"hi" ]; 데이터 타입 상관X .push() : 배열 추가 오브젝트 const player = { name: "..
[CSS] 생활코딩 반응형 디자인, 미디어쿼리, CSS 파일
반응형 디자인 (responsive design) 화면 크기에 따라 웹 페이지 각 요소가 최적화되는 디자인 미디어 쿼리 조건문 CSS @media(min-width:800px) { } 중복제거 : CSS 파일 *
[CSS] 생활코딩 box model : block, inline, div, span, grid
*주석 : /* */ *element = tag 태그 별로 화면에서 차지하는 크기에 따라 기본값 구분 1. block 화면 전체를 차지 2. inline 필요한 자신의 부피만 차지 display block 변경 inline none 숨기기 타이핑 줄이기 같은 내용의 스타일 적용 : 콤마로 잇기 같은 속성의 세부 옵션 : 속성 뒤에 순서없이 작성 주요 CSS 속성 border 테두리 padding 안쪽 여백 margin 바깥 여백 width 크기 display 화면 차지 공간 div division 무색무취, 아무런 용도 없이 디자인 용도로만 사용 block : 화면 전체 사용, 줄바꿈 span div와 같이 디자인 용도 inline level element grid display: gird; gird-t..
[CSS] 기초 복습 : id, class,
- 디자인에 관한 정보만 지님 1. style 태그를 쓴다 - 에 작성 - a { color:red; } - 중복된 제거 a : 선택자 { } : 선언자 color : 속성 red : value 2. style 속성을 쓴다 - 태그 안에 작성 : 단락 위에 여백 삽입 : 크기 조정 id #id : 최우선 선택자 단 한번만 등장해야 함 구체적, 예외적 #id ul : id div 아래 ul에만 적용시키도록 설정 class .class : 선택자 : 여러개의 속성 값 가능, 띄어쓰기 구분 여러개의 선택자를 통해 공동 제어 가능 중간 우선순위 : body와 가까이 있는 명령이 우선순위 태그 선택자 우선순위 가장 낮음 가장 마지막 등장하는 선택자가 우선순위가 높음